SoftBank’s Humanoid Robots Will Be Sold In U.S. Stores By Summer 2015

Softbank Corp. has announced the company will begin selling its humanoid robots named “Pepper” at United States-based Sprint Corp. stores by the summer of 2015. The company has yet to set a U.S. price for Pepper, but the robot will go on sale in Japan in February for 198,000 yen ($1,900). Fumihide Tomizawa, chief executive […]

Samsung Buys Home Automation Startup, SmartThings, For $200 Million

Samsung just acquired a 2-year-old home automation startup company, SmartThings, for $200 million in an effort to revamp the home appliance industry. SmartThings is a company that launched in order to make home-automation products capable of communicating with each other, for example you refrigerator talking to your microwave. Siemens Rail Automation Expanding As a Result Of Growing Demand For Automation Technology

Siemens Rail Automation is bringing its East Pittsburgh and 18th Street facilities together on a new site in Munhall in order to expand its manufacturing and engineering capabilities. Siemens is investing $1 million into the new site and expects to provide 129 new jobs as the demand for automation technology continues to grow, especially Positive […]
